Japanese Greetings
1) "Good morning - OHAYO"
”Ohayo gozaimasu" is a polite expression of "Ohayo," and used also to address elders.
2) "Hello - KONNICHIWA"

3) "Good evening - KONBANWA"

4) What? Are there two greetings at night?
"OYASUMI" or "OYASUMINASAI" is a farewell greeting at night. Or I use it when I sleep (When I go to bed). "Oyasuminasai is a polite expression of "OYASUMI," and used also to address elders.
"KONBANWA" is when you meet someone at night.
Also, don't forget to practice bowing when greeting. Bowing makes you look more Japanese.
